  • No, you have complete control over your belongings. You decide if it is something you want to keep or let go. I will help guide you in the decision-making process and help you make the most of your space. You will never feel pressured into discarding a cherished item.

  • You can be as involved as much or as little as you want. Some clients work beside me the entire time, while others give me parameters of what should stay or go and have me do the rest. As a professional organizer, I am comfortable with tackling the project on my own so that you can spend your time and energy elsewhere.

    At the end of your organizing project, it is helpful to walk you through the placement of items so that you are familiar with where the items belong and how to keep up with your newly established systems.

  • Not every person is born organized. Organization can certainly be taught and refined over time. I work with people and families to set up systems that meet them where they are. Every situation and space is unique and so are the systems we put in place. Once I figure out what works best for you, I help you develop a plan to maintain your organized spaces.

  • Every client and project is unique. During your consultation, I will estimate the number of sessions or hours your project may take. However, the length of the process depends on the number of rooms, size of the spaces, amount of clutter, and how motivated you are to get organized.

    Decision fatigue can occur during major organizing projects. Progress can speed up or slow down depending on how easy it is for you to make decisions during the process.
